Understanding File Transfers

Factors Affecting File Transfer Sizes

The transfer of files to an external hard drive can vary based on several factors, including:

  1. File System Limitations: Different file systems (e.g., NTFS, FAT32, exFAT) have unique characteristics and limitations. For instance, FAT32 has a maximum file size limit of 4GB, which means larger files cannot be transferred to a FAT32 drive. If your external hard drive is formatted with FAT32 and you attempt to transfer a file larger than this limit, the transfer will fail, regardless of how much free space is available.

How to Avoid File Transfer Issues

Now that we've identified the problem, here are practical solutions to ensure smooth file transfers to your external hard drive:

  1. Check File System Format: Ensure your external hard drive is formatted with a file system that suits your needs. For large files, NTFS or exFAT are preferable as they support larger file sizes compared to FAT32.

  2. Defragment Your Drive: Use built-in utilities to defragment your drive, thus consolidating free space. This will create larger contiguous blocks of free space, making it easier to transfer files.

  3. Monitor Disk Quotas: If using a shared drive or working in an environment that implements disk quotas, check your available space and current usage to ensure you do not exceed limits.
